DarkPaladin87 wrote:Since my match with Jansen in the djarvik open against marlon i realized Jansen suits my style somewhat better. I used to play with Burns but it´s hard to cope with 54 power and a weak wing of 51, especially on return games. Jansen instead has mediocre groundstrokes 68 and 63 but compensates that with high power 77.

I see myself as an agressive baseliner who rushes the net when possible. That is on return games, when i serve i S&V like 80%. With that statement Jansen might be better for me, especially on clay.

I can't let you say Jansen is a good baseliner. If you're with him means that you're a good player cause he has no wing weapon.
I like Jansen very much but it s because I play a lot at the net. If you don't rush the net, it's really tough to battle from the baseline against a good baseliner.
More over, I don't think there is a huge difference between 74 or75 and 77 in power. Cool to have 77 though !! :wink:

I just noticed really how easy it is to serve with the buttons using nakamura, especially just using the right trigger, now i know how people hit those slice serves constantly. I think if you could only use the stick, serving would be harder and less consistent, especially slices as i find them hard to keep pulling off. Ive been trying to use the buttons to get more variety, not too comfy with them though. And i think naka is definetely the toughest player, i'm abandoning trying to serve and volley againt one, i'm afraid it will have to be naka vs naka, the returns are just way too good and being has burns has the big disadvantage of 51 FH, 53 return and 54 power lol i find it hard to cope with the slices to the forehand, so for now i'll fight naka with naka, so to speak.
